Screen recording with voiceover – iPad or iPhone

Screen recorders are used to record videos that teach how to do something on a device step by step. Because they’re extremely easy to follow. The student or learner has the freedom to stop to understand what’s going on whenever he wants. They’re often used by instructors to make the class interactive and engaging.

In such a tutorial, voiceovers are widely used to help the student or learner understand the tutorial better. A tutorial without a voiceover is likely to be boring as well as less engaging.

Enable Screen Recording

  • Go to “Settings” > “Control Center”.
  • Tap on the green plus “+” button next to the “Screen Recording” control.

Screen Recording control is enabled.

Start a screen recording

  • Swipe down from the top-right corner of your device.
  • Simply tap the Screen Recording button to start a screen recording instantly.

Enable Microphone

If you want to record your screen with your voice for a tutorial (or any kind of personal instruction), you have to enable the device’s microphone before you tap the “Screen Record” button. Let’s do that:

  • Tap-and-hold the “Screen Record” button.
  • Tap “Microphone” to enable microphone.
  • Tap “Start Recording”.

To end a recording

Once you end or stop the recording, it will be saved to your camera roll (if any other option isn’t selected).

  • Tap the red flashing recoding indicator in the status bar.
